Central Government Extends Import Duty Exemption on Cotton till 31st December 2025

#Cotton #TextileIndustry #CentralGovernment #DutyExemption #Exports #CottonImports #IndianEconomy #MakeInIndia #TradeBoost #PIB New Delhi: In a move aimed at supporting the Indian textile industry and exporters, the Central Government has announced the extension of the import duty exemption on cotton (HS 5201) until 31st December 2025. Earlier, the exemption was granted for a short period, from 19th August 2025 to 30th September 2025, to ensure better availability of cotton for the domestic market. Canada Sees Steep Decline in Student and Temporary Worker Arrivals in 2025 Amid Policy Shift

#CanadaImmigration #InternationalStudents #TemporaryWorkers #HousingCrisis #CanadianEconomy #PolicyShift #WorkPermits #StudyPermits #LabourShortage #MigrationPolicy Ottawa: Canada is witnessing a dramatic decline in the number of international students and temporary workers entering the country, reflecting the government’s strategic push to rebalance immigration and ease pressure on housing, infrastructure, and essential services. Fresh data released up to June 30, 2025, shows a sharp drop of 214,520 arrivals compared to the same period last year. The fall is split between two categories: international students, down by 88,617, and temporary foreign workers, down by 125,903.
